    Abstract:

    Differences in the population of culturable microorganisms and the enzymatic activities between soils amended with Bt-transgenic rice straw and non Bt-transgenic rice straw,respectively,were invest igated under laboratory conditions No significant differences(p<0.05) were observed in CFU(colony forming units) of culturable bacteria,act inomycetes and fungi between the two soils Although some apparent differences were observed in the populations of ammonifying bacteria,nitrogen fixing bacteria and cellulose-decomposing bacteria in the middle of the incubation,they did not last long Responses of various soil enzymes to the incorporation of Bt-transgenic rice straw and non Bt-transgenic rice straw varied No significant differences(p<0.05) in protease activities,neutral phosphatase activities,urease activities and respiration activities were found between the soil amended with Bt-transgenic rice straw and the soil blended with non Bt-transgenic rice straw Soil dehydrogenase was more sensitive than the other enzymes to amendment of the Bt-transgenic rice straw into soil Dehydrogenase activities in the soil amended with Bttransgenic rice straw were significantly higher(p<0.05) as compared to those in the soil with non Bt transgenic rice straw,and the apparent differences in the soil dehydrogenase activities,however,disappeared after incubation for 63 days Results indicate that the cry 1Ab toxin in straws of Bt-transgenic rice appears to be in toxic to the culturable microorganisms in upland soil.
